Equipment and requirements
Equipment has slots and equip rules. Two-handed weapons, shields, level gates, class/race restrictions and skill requirements can block an equip attempt. Use the Items database for exact item stats.
Loot and autoloot
Loot can come from defeated NPCs, bosses, raids, and other rewards. Autoloot is a convenience feature, not a replacement for understanding weight, slots, and stack limits.
Weight, inventory and depot
Carrying too much affects movement and practical hunt length. Depot storage and containers let you separate valuable gear, crafting materials, food and trash loot.
